> I've tested a camel-amqp component with ActiveMQ Artemis (AMQ) system and detected that all Camel Headers (in my case CamelHttp* ) were propagated inside the message properties.
> Next, changed some (JmsTransferExchangeTest, JmsInOutTransferExchangeTest) transferExchange related tests (from 'transferExchange=true' to 'transferExchange=false') and all test were passed successfully that looks very strange.
> This issue need to be verify.
